Their whole album consists of cheesy but catchy love songs that immediately serenade any girl that listens to them. The voices, and not to mention looks, of the four British, and one Irish, band members, Niall Horan, Zayn Malik, Liam Payne, Harry Styles and Louis Tomlinson, first caught everyone’s attention on the seventh season of The X Factor. They originally auditioned as soloists, but after being rejected from the “Boys” category they banded together and made the “Groups” category, thus becoming “One Direction.” Shortly after coming in third place, they signed a record deal with judge Simon Cowell. Their debut album, Up All Night and debut single “What Makes You Beautiful” have been at the top of music charts ever since. Their song “Forever Young,” which would have been released if they won, was leaked onto the internet and has over seven million views on YouTube. The band also published a book titled One Direction: Forever Young , about their entire X Factor journey. One Direction’s album has an overdose of flirty pop songs with perfect harmonies that are making tweens and teens alike swoon. Though the whole album has the obvious “love” theme, each song itself has it’s own classic twist and the album never seems repetitive. Their song “Gotta Be You” is a more romantic melody with soaring vocals, while “Up All Night” is a flirtier and upbeat song that makes anyone who listens want to dance. The band belts out “One Thing” as a pleading and catchy love song, and “Stole My Heart” is a more electronic and soft love ballot.
